Why this Role? The rapid adoption of AI has driven significant growth in demand across global data center markets. To support this expansion, Client's Energy business is focused on delivering reliable power solutions through Genset products for large-scale data center campuses. The Logistics Analyst plays a critical role in enabling this growth by serving as the link between customer demand and operational execution. In this role, you will receive customer orders, analyze demand requirements, and manage accurate order entry and fulfillment within Client's ERP systems. By ensuring orders are properly structured, visible, and executable, the Logistics Analyst helps protect customer commitments, support production planning, and enable on-time delivery in a fast-growing, high-impact market.

  • This position operates in a fast?
paced, cross?functional manufacturing environment within Client's Aftertreatment business. The role works closely with production scheduling, supply chain, logistics, and engineering teams to support order flow and execution. Daily work involves data analysis, ERP system interaction, and coordination across multiple stakeholders to ensure accurate demand visibility and smooth operational execution in support of customer and regulatory requirements.
